The NEW Launch Plan: 152 Tips, Tactics and Trends from the Most Memorable New Products

Building on eight years of knowledge and data compiled from Schneider’s Most Memorable New Product Launch Survey (MMNPL), The NEW Launch Plan: 152 Tips, Tactics and Trends from the Most Memorable New Products, examines successful launch strategies and tactics used by top tier consumer product companies. The annual Most Memorable New Product Launch Survey, sponsored by Schneider Associates, IRI and Sentient Decision Science, surveys more than 1,000 U.S. consumers about the most memorable new product launches of the year, as well as current purchasing and behavioral trends.
